Σελίδα 30 - Therefore all the interior angles of the figure, together with four right angles, are equal to twice as many right angles as the figure has sides.
Σελίδα 96 - The angle in a semicircle is a right angle ; the angle in a segment greater than a semicircle is less than a right angle ; and the angle in a segment less than a semicircle is greater than a right angle.

Σελίδα 58 - If a straight line be divided into two equal parts, and also into two unequal parts; the rectangle contained by the unequal parts, together with the square of the line between the points of section, is equal to the square of half the line.
Σελίδα 61 - A fourth proportional to three quantities is the fourth term of a proportion, whose first three terms are the three quantities taken in their order. Thus, in the proportion a : b = c : d, d is a fourth proportional to a, b, and c.
